## Build Provenance: PayLedger Export Change

Heads up, plugin folks — starting with the Quillbrook 4.2 line, the payroll export format moves from pipe-delimited to versioned JSON envelopes. Your parsers will break if you assume column order, so pin against the schema, not position. Every export build now carries provenance metadata so you can verify which pipeline produced your file. The token for the current release build is below.

pipeline stamp: htk31_f769b577b3028a4e9958e5bb8d1259a

TURN-208: Gatevale turnstile counters at the Merrow Field pilot double-count when a rotation reverses mid-cycle. Attendance totals drift roughly 2% high per event. The debounce window fix is implemented, reviewed by Ilsa, and soak-tested across two simulated match days without drift. Ready for your cut; the candidate build is identified below.

trace token, tagag-tafog: htk6_5ed18c

Escalation: If the GiftLeaf donation-receipt mailer queues more than 500 undelivered receipts for 30 minutes, page the on-call via the Donor Comms rotation. Verify the signing key for receipt PDFs has not expired before restarting workers; a stale key silently voids receipts. For audit questions or suspected tampering, reach the mailer security owner directly.

alerts address for kajog-tadup: druox@plorvanet.internal